David H. Lammlein is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Media Technology and Control and Systems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, David H. Lammlein has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 618 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 2 papers in Media Technology and 1 paper in Control and Systems Engineering. Recurrent topics in David H. Lammlein's work include Advanced Welding Techniques Analysis (10 papers), Welding Techniques and Residual Stresses (8 papers) and Metal Forming Simulation Techniques (3 papers). David H. Lammlein is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Welding Techniques Analysis (10 papers), Welding Techniques and Residual Stresses (8 papers) and Metal Forming Simulation Techniques (3 papers). David H. Lammlein collaborates with scholars based in United States. David H. Lammlein's co-authors include Alvin M. Strauss, Chase Cox, Gerald Cook, William R. Longhurst, Brian Gibson, Tracie Prater, George E. Cook, Paul Fleming, D.M. Wilkes and Matt Bement and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Manufacturing Processes, Materials and Manufacturing Processes and Science and Technology of Welding & Joining.

All Works

10 of 10 papers shown
1.
Gibson, Brian, David H. Lammlein, Tracie Prater, et al.. (2013). Friction stir welding: Process, automation, and control. Journal of Manufacturing Processes. 16(1). 56–73. 408 indexed citations breakdown →
2.
Lammlein, David H., et al.. (2011). The friction stir welding of small-diameter pipe: an experimental and numerical proof of concept for automation and manufacturing. Proceedings of the Institution of Mechanical Engineers Part B Journal of Engineering Manufacture. 226(3). 383–398. 48 indexed citations
3.
Fleming, Paul, et al.. (2011). Hydrogen generation for sensing and control in submerged friction stir welding. Proceedings of the Institution of Mechanical Engineers Part L Journal of Materials Design and Applications. 226(1). 72–75. 3 indexed citations
4.
Longhurst, William R., et al.. (2010). Heated Friction Stir Welding: An Experimental and Theoretical Investigation into How Preheating Influences Process Forces. Materials and Manufacturing Processes. 25(11). 1283–1291. 55 indexed citations
5.
Cox, Chase, David H. Lammlein, Alvin M. Strauss, & George E. Cook. (2010). Modeling the Control of an Elevated Tool Temperature and the Affects on Axial Force During Friction Stir Welding. Materials and Manufacturing Processes. 25(11). 1278–1282. 13 indexed citations
6.
Fleming, Paul, Christopher Hendricks, George E. Cook, et al.. (2010). Seam-Tracking for Friction Stir Welded Lap Joints. Journal of Materials Engineering and Performance. 19(8). 1128–1132. 11 indexed citations
7.
Lammlein, David H., et al.. (2009). The application of shoulderless conical tools in friction stir welding: An experimental and theoretical study. Materials & Design (1980-2015). 30(10). 4012–4022. 23 indexed citations
8.
Fleming, Paul, David H. Lammlein, D.M. Wilkes, et al.. (2008). In‐process gap detection in friction stir welding. Sensor Review. 28(1). 62–67. 36 indexed citations
9.
Fleming, Paul, David H. Lammlein, D.M. Wilkes, et al.. (2008). Misalignment detection for friction stir welding or Enabling seam tracking for friction stir welding. 1 indexed citations
10.
Fleming, Paul, David H. Lammlein, D.M. Wilkes, et al.. (2008). Misalignment detection and enabling of seam tracking for friction stir welding. Science and Technology of Welding & Joining. 14(1). 93–96. 20 indexed citations
